The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of William Anderson, born in 1849 in Clerkenwell, Middlesex, consisted of 6 members. William was the head of the household, married to Louisa Anderson, born in 1849 in Basingstoke, Hampshire, England. They had 2 children; Fredrick (born 1879 in Royal Tunbridge Wells, Kent, England) and Arthur (born 1881 in Leigh, Kent, England).
During the period, also present in the household were William's Boarder, Thomas (born 1862 in Sevenoaks, Kent, England) and William's Servant, Mary A (born 1865 in East Peckham, Kent, England).
